ALISTAIR McGowan is to lead a stellar cast of local, national and Internationally renowned performers in a gala live concert in aid of the Ukrainian people at St Laurence’s Church.

Ludlow resident Mr McGowan, the hugely popular TV impressionist, comic, actor and singer, will be joined by a host of musicians and composers to perform “In Unison With Ukraine” a concert to raise funds for the Disaster Emergency Committee Ukrainian humanitarian appeal.

The list of top rank International stars includes the brilliant Ukrainian bass-baritone opera singer Vasyl Savenko, a leading interpreter of Ukrainian Art Song.

Mr Savenko has sung principal roles for major opera houses in his native Ukraine and also with the Bolshoi and Kirov Opera Theatres in Russia.

“I absolutely condemn the Russian invasion and its devastating consequences, but feel a deep anguish over the resulting divisions between people who have considered themselves as one nation,” said Mr Savenko, who was born in the Odessa region of the Ukraine.

“Millions of Ukrainians are married to Russians and vice versa and there was a popular exchange in education, culture and sport: I started my vocal studies at the Odessa conservatoire and finished at Moscow’s Tchaikovsky conservatoire.

“This brutal, senseless war has created a terrible humanitarian crisis and vast sums of money and support are needed to help the millions of refugees and for the rebuilding of the nation, so I’m particularly happy to participate in this concert ‘In unison with Ukraine.”

The event is being organised by Ludlow resident Kim Begley, a former principal tenor at the Royal Opera House, who has sung in all the great opera houses of the world and his opera singer wife Elizabeth.

Also starring will be Charlotte Page, a leading lady in international opera houses and theatres alike, whose credits include Christine in Phantom Of The Opera and who once sang at a birthday party for Sir Elton John.
